About 4-cyclopropyl-5-ethyl-6-methylpyridin-2-amine
4-cyclopropyl-5-ethyl-6-methylpyridin-2-amine (PubChem CID 118491476) has the molecular formula C11H16N2
and a molecular weight of 176.26 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is 4-cyclopropyl-5-ethyl-6-methylpyridin-2-amine.
